Description

The king of the dinosaurs, Tyrannosaurus Rex, has long captured the imaginations of young paleontologists the world over. The cover of this stunning book, with its popping 3-D T. Rex grabs children's attention and draws them to the many other dinosaurs to be found within. And once the spiral-bound pages have been opened, young readers can discover full-color illustrations of dinosaur anatomy, environments, fossilized remains, and more. Zip pouches within protect two extra-large color posters and an easy-to-build dinosaur model. This ultimate guide to dinosaurs provides both educational instruction and exciting amusement for dinosaur enthusiasts of all stripes.

Author Biography:

Jozua Douglas (1977) was born in a teeny-weeny house near the banks in the North of the Netherlands. (Some say his distant grandfather was a famous knight who lived in a huge castle in Scotland, and that his English great-grandfather discovered Charlie Chaplin.) At the age of six, he learned how to write. He bought himself a notebook, made up stories and went on many exciting adventures with pirates, knights, and astronauts. Since then, Jozua has never stopped writing. There is nothing he enjoys more than writing for children. Jozua: ‘Children are open-minded and have lots of imagination. Their world is magical and mysterious. It’s a big challenge to work in this world. Now, Jozua Douglas lives and works in Den Dolder, as an independent writer. I am Barbara van Rheenen was born in Amsterdam on February 14th, 1967. I was raised in a big family where music and art were always present. Soon drawing became my favorite hobby. At school, I had a hard time concentrating and they called me the dream queen so after school I quickly got a job. I love to travel and I love the sea and especially everything that lives in the sea. I worked for four years for Greenpeace and fell in love with whales. At that time I made my first two books with Clavis. I made an educational book about whales and illustrated a book about dinosaurs. In my life there are no straight lines and that you can also see in my drawings. I like to work with a pencil, a lot of colors on top of each other. Then there is a world that exists on its own on the paper. When I’m not illustrating I’m working in the shipping and boat industry, the world of the water.
